MasterChef Australia insider has revealed that Channel Ten have had their eye on new judge Poh Ling Yeow as far back as 2019. 

The former contestant was considered as a replacement for outgoing judges Matt Preston, George Calombaris and Gary Mehigan when they were booted that year.

'The conversations around the boardroom started with a dream team of judges that would work well together and Poh was on that list for sure,' the source told Yahoo.

The plans were put on ice however, with producers allegedly keen to get Poh and former winner Julie Goodwin to return for the Back to Win celebrity season. 

The pause allowed Poh to gain further TV experience, as did her appearance on other shows.
